蜂鸟e203系统移植:从arty a7开发板到其他开发板的实践分享

蜂鸟e203系统移植,可以移植到其他开发板
现有移植到 arty a7开发板的

ID:696800672837885005

文滔武略天下第_


蜂鸟E203系统移植,可以拓展到其他开发板

摘要:

蜂鸟E203是一款基于RISC-V指令集架构的开发板,具备低功耗、高性能等特性,因此备受开发者的青睐。本文以蜂鸟E203为主题,探讨了其系统移植的相关技术,并通过实例介绍了如何将蜂鸟E203系统移植至Arty A7开发板。此外,我们还探讨了将蜂鸟E203系统移植到其他开发板的可能性和可行性,为广大开发者提供了更多灵活的选择。

  1. 引言

蜂鸟E203开发板作为一款基于RISC-V指令集架构的硬件平台,具备了低功耗、高性能等优势,广受关注和喜爱。其开放性和灵活性使得开发者们可以充分发挥自己的创造力,将蜂鸟E203系统移植到不同的硬件平台上,以实现更加个性化和多样化的项目需求。

  1. 蜂鸟E203系统移植原理

2.1 系统移植概述

蜂鸟E203系统移植是指将蜂鸟E203开发板上的操作系统和相应的应用软件移植到其他硬件平台上的过程。移植的关键在于保持原有系统的功能完整性和性能表现,并在新的硬件平台上实现稳定运行。系统移植主要包含硬件适配、驱动移植、软件调试等步骤。

2.2 硬件适配

蜂鸟E203系统移植的第一步是进行硬件适配。在移植到其他开发板时,需要根据目标硬件的硬件规格和接口定义,对蜂鸟E203的硬件进行适配。这包括连接接口、芯片选型、时钟频率等。通过适配工作,确保蜂鸟E203系统能够正常运行并与目标硬件进行良好的通信。

2.3 驱动移植

驱动移植是蜂鸟E203系统移植的关键环节。蜂鸟E203系统中的各种外设和芯片都需要相应的驱动程序支持才能正常工作。在移植过程中,需要重新开发或适配驱动程序,以保证目标硬件平台上的外设和芯片能够与蜂鸟E203系统正确地进行交互。

2.4 软件调试

在完成硬件适配和驱动移植后,需要对移植的系统进行软件调试。这包括对系统的稳定性、性能、兼容性等方面进行测试和优化。通过逐步调试和测试,确保移植后的系统能够稳定运行,并保持原有的功能和性能。

  1. 蜂鸟E203系统移植到Arty A7开发板的实例

作为一个实际应用实例,我们将详细介绍如何将蜂鸟E203系统成功移植到Arty A7开发板上。

3.1 硬件适配

首先,我们需要了解Arty A7开发板的硬件规格和接口定义。根据规格,我们进行硬件适配工作,确保蜂鸟E203与Arty A7之间的连接适配正确,芯片选型和时钟频率设置正确。

3.2 驱动移植

接下来,我们需要对Arty A7开发板的外设和芯片进行驱动移植。这包括针对Arty A7的外设编写或适配相应的驱动程序,以保证蜂鸟E203与Arty A7之间的数据交互和通信能够正常进行。

3.3 软件调试

在完成硬件适配和驱动移植后,我们需要对移植后的系统进行软件调试。通过逐步测试和优化,确保蜂鸟E203系统在Arty A7开发板上的稳定性和性能表现。

  1. 蜂鸟E203系统移植到其他开发板的可行性分析

除了Arty A7开发板以外,蜂鸟E203系统还可以移植到其他各类开发板上。这取决于目标开发板的硬件规格和接口定义是否与蜂鸟E203兼容。如果兼容,我们可以按照与Arty A7类似的流程进行硬件适配、驱动移植和软件调试工作。

  1. 总结

本文围绕蜂鸟E203系统移植展开,以Arty A7开发板为例,介绍了蜂鸟E203系统移植的原理和实例。通过硬件适配、驱动移植和软件调试等步骤,成功将蜂鸟E203系统移植到Arty A7开发板上,并探讨了将蜂鸟E203系统移植到其他开发板的可行性。希望本文能为广大开发者在蜂鸟E203系统移植方面提供一定的参考和帮助。

关键词:蜂鸟E203、系统移植、开发板、硬件适配、驱动移植、软件调试

以上相关代码,程序地址:http://matup.cn/672837885005.html

  • 27
    点赞
  • 34
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值